apt install tightvncserver -y
apt install dbus-x11 -y
vncpasswd
mkdir -p ~/.vnc
# ایجاد فایل xstartup با محتوای صحیح
cat > ~/.vnc/xstartup << 'EOF'
#!/bin/bash
unset SESSION_MANAGER
unset DBUS_SESSION_BUS_ADDRESS
export XKL_XMODMAP_DISABLE=1
export XDG_CURRENT_DESKTOP="LXDE"
exec startlxde
EOF
# دادن مجوز اجرا
chmod +x ~/.vnc/xstartup
vncserver :1 -geometry 1024x768
vncserver -kill :1
دستور آخر برای قطع سرور است، دستور قبلیش برای شروع سرور است. برای تست اول ، دستور شروع را بزنید و اگر مشکلی بود دستور قطع رابزنید و اصلاحات را انجام دهید و دوباره دستور شروع را بزنید.
اون تکه سبز را یک تکه کپی و اجرا کنید.
دستورات این دو پست را اجرا کردم و بدون هیچ مشکلی lxde نمایش داده شد.ولی ممکن است سیستم شما تفاوتهایی داشته باشد و یا ضعیف تر باشد.
با openbox راه اندازی را اول تست کنید و بعد که راه اندازی اکی شد فقط کافیه محتوای فایل استارت را عوض کنید تا lxde نمایش پیدا کند.
deepseek را وادار کنید دستورات تشخیص بدهد و نتیجه را به خودش بدهید تا بگه مشکل چیه و بخواهید براتون توضیح بده قضیه چیه.
گاهی پیشنهادهای عوضی می کند. ازش دانش بگیرید و خودتون فرمان دستتون باشه.
خیلی اشکالات ممکنه میش بیاید که در این تاپیک بحث نشده باشد. و نیاز است از deepseek کمک بگیرید. راه انداختن deepseek خودش یک مهارت است. باید خوب برایش توضیح بدهید مشکل چیه. اگر او مشکل را بداند راه حل را احتمال زیاد می داند.